- [ ] Key ceremony, item 12 — Billing worker blue-green cutover key. Before rotating traffic from the blue Ledgerline billing worker to green, future maintainers must verify both environments share the same schema version and that the green worker has processed at least one shadow invoice cleanly. Document the cutover timestamp in the ceremony log. The sealed key material for the green environment is unlocked with the passphrase below.

unlock words, bahop-fawef: novmir-druwyn-soriel-rusdor-kasion

Runbook: Tallowgate alert deduplicator. Before each release, verify the dedup window is set to 120 seconds and that suppression rules loaded cleanly; a failed rule load silently disables dedup, flooding on-call with duplicates. Check the /rules/status endpoint and confirm the last reload timestamp is within the hour. If stale, trigger a manual reload and watch the event counter for thirty seconds. As release manager, you can invoke the reload endpoint directly using the service key provided below.

API key for yahig-tadup: kto7_ubizbYm

Hi all,

As of next sprint, stewardship of the Quillstack dependency pinning policy is changing hands. For future maintainers: the policy requires exact-version pins in all service manifests, weekly automated bump proposals, and a documented exception process for security patches that must land out of cycle. The rationale doc, the exception log, and the bump-bot configuration all move with this handover, so please update your bookmarks accordingly. Effective Monday, the single accountable owner for the policy is the person named below.

account owner for fajep-yagef: Kasix Eliiel

Subject: Partner SFTP drop — new owner

Hi,

As you review the pending changes to the Harborline ingest scripts, note that ownership of the partner SFTP drop is changing at the end of the month. This includes key rotation, the nightly pull job, and the quarantine folder for malformed files. Review comments on the retry logic should still go through the normal PR flow, but questions about drop-folder conventions or partner onboarding now go to the new owner. The incoming owner is listed below.

signatory, tagaf-bahaf: Praael Fenmir Rusok